A video from the IPL 2026 match between Rajasthan Royals and Punjab Kings has gone viral, showing Riyan Parag vaping inside the team's dressing room. The incident occurred during the broadcast while cameras briefly cut to the players. The footage has drawn strong reactions from fans and commentators, raising questions about player conduct in high-visibility situations. Vaping and e-cigarettes are banned in India, and while no official confirmation of a breach has been released, the visuals have prompted discussions about potential disciplinary action under the league's code of conduct. Neither the IPL nor Rajasthan Royals have issued a detailed statement yet. The controversy has sparked a broader conversation about the responsibilities of professional athletes, especially in a league as globally watched as the IPL. Despite Rajasthan Royals winning the match, the focus quickly shifted to the viral clip, overshadowing the team's on-field achievement. For Parag, who has been under the spotlight for his performances this season, the incident adds to the scrutiny surrounding him. As the video continues to circulate, attention now turns to whether the IPL governing body will take cognizance of the incident.
